// 每日前端夜话 第405篇
// 正文共:1100 字
// 预计阅读时间:5 分钟
// 每日前端夜话 第405篇
// 正文共:1100 字
// 预计阅读时间:5 分钟 介绍JavaScript 是一种动态类型的语言,这意味着解释器是在运行时确定变量类型的。这允许我们可以用同一变量中存储不同类型的数据。但是如果没有文档和保持一致性,在使用代码时,我们很有可能并不知道变量究竟是哪种类
转载
2023-09-29 07:09:29
83阅读
# JavaScript 判断输入是否是数字
在编程中,我们常常需要判断一个输入是否为数字。在 JavaScript 中,数字的判断不仅仅是看它的类型,还是要考虑到输入的格式。本文将详细介绍如何在 JavaScript 中判断输入是否是数字,并提供一些示例代码。
## 什么是数字?
在 JavaScript 中,数字可以是整数或浮点数。我们使用 `Number` 类型来表示数字。例如,`42
原创
2024-10-12 06:43:33
163阅读
# JavaScript 判断输入是否是数字
在 JavaScript 中,我们经常需要判断用户输入的数据类型。特别是当我们需要处理数值计算时,确保输入是数字非常重要。本文将介绍如何使用 JavaScript 判断输入是否是数字的方法,并提供相关的代码示例。
## 什么是数字
数字是一种基本的数据类型,用于表示数值。在 JavaScript 中,数字可以包含整数、小数和科学计数法表示的数值。
原创
2023-08-06 21:16:08
642阅读
一.JS数据类型(8种) JS数据类型有八种,其实原本js数据类型有6种Number,String,Boolean,undefined,object,Null。想必这几种大家都耳熟能详了吧。但是!!重点来了,ES6中新增了一种Symbol。然后在谷歌67版本中还出现了一种bigint。所以一共是八种,接下来开始讲解每一种数据类型。1.Numbe
转载
2023-10-07 22:42:05
301阅读
isNaN(123)
isNaN(-1.23)
isNaN(5-2)
isNaN(0)
isNaN("Hello")
isNaN("2005/12/12")false
false
false
false
true
true
转载
2023-06-09 11:02:01
433阅读
JavaScript判断输入是否为数字类型的方法总结前言很多时候需要判断一个输入是否位数字,下面简单列举集中方法。第一种方法 isNaNisNaN 返回一个 Boolean 值,指明提供的值是否是保留值 NaN (不是数字)。 NaN 即 Not a Number isNaN(numValue)但是如果numValue果是一个空串或是一个空格,而isNaN是做为数字0进行
转载
2023-06-09 14:40:35
196阅读
# JavaScript 数字判断
在现代编程中,数字的处理与判断是不可或缺的一部分,尤其是 JavaScript 这样一种广泛使用的语言。本文将介绍如何在 JavaScript 中进行数字判断,包括判断数字的类型、范围以及一些特殊情况的处理。
## 一、判断数据类型
在 JavaScript 中,数据类型的判断常常使用 `typeof` 操作符。当我们需要判断一个变量是否为数字时,可以使用
javascript没有直接判断是否是数字的函数。我编程进行翻页时要判断用户输入的是否为数字,
我在网上看到这样一个判断地函数:
//数字的确定
function isDigit(theNum)
{
var theMask = "0123456789";
if (isEmpty(theNum)) return (false);
else if (theMask.indexOf(th
转载
2009-03-12 11:02:00
527阅读
2评论
# JavaScript判断数字实现流程
## 1. 判断数字的概念
在开始实现之前,首先需要了解什么是数字。在计算机编程中,数字是一种基本的数据类型,用来表示数值。我们可以对数字进行各种数学运算和比较操作。
## 2. 判断数字的流程
为了帮助小白理解,我们可以使用以下表格展示判断数字的流程:
| 步骤 | 代码 | 注释 |
|---|---|---|
| 1 | typeof操作符 |
原创
2023-08-08 09:53:46
60阅读
用正则表达式判断。如果纯数字是指整数的话(不包含小数点),可以这样:function check(){
var value = document.getElementById("inputId").value;
var reg=/^[1-9]\d*$|^0$/; // 注意:故意限制了 0321 这种格式,如不需要,直接reg=/^\d+$/;
if(reg.test(value)==true)
转载
2023-06-06 10:08:55
1254阅读
有谁知道如何检查JavaScript中的变量是数字还是字符串? #1楼 如果要处理文字符号而不是构造函数,则可以使用typeof:。 typeof "Hello World"; // string
typeof 123; // number 如果要通过构造函数(例如var foo = new String("foo")创建数字和字符串,则应记住typeof可能会返回foo ob
转载
2023-10-07 22:35:13
103阅读
有时候我们输入的input的内容需要判断一下是否是数字,所以为了更好的客户体验,在前端先处理一下:<input type="text" name="val" class="val" /> 1 var t = document.getElementsByClassName('val')[0];
2 t.onchange = function(){
3 var val = t
转载
2023-06-14 17:25:30
326阅读
# JavaScript判断是否数字
JavaScript是一门广泛应用于Web开发的脚本语言,它为网页增加了交互性和动态性。在处理用户输入或进行数据验证时,我们经常需要判断一个值是否为数字。本文将介绍如何使用JavaScript来判断一个值是否为数字,并提供代码示例。
## JavaScript的数据类型
在JavaScript中,有多种数据类型,包括数字(Number)、字符串(Stri
原创
2023-08-07 09:31:53
313阅读
<html>
<head>
<title>判断是否为数字及空格</title>
<script type="text/javascript" src="jquery.min.js"></script> //这里有无也无所谓
<script type="text/j
原创
2011-08-17 00:22:20
735阅读
## JavaScript判断输入数字
在JavaScript中,我们经常需要判断用户输入的数据类型,特别是当我们需要进行数学计算或其他数字相关操作时。本文将介绍一些方法来判断输入是否为数字,并提供了相应的代码示例。
### 使用typeof操作符
JavaScript提供了typeof操作符,用于返回一个值的数据类型。我们可以使用typeof操作符来判断输入是否为数字。下面是一个示例:
原创
2023-08-02 04:42:45
454阅读
# JavaScript判断数字大小
在JavaScript中,我们可以使用不同的方法来比较和判断数字的大小。在本文中,我们将介绍常用的几种方法,并提供相应的代码示例。
## 1. 使用比较运算符
JavaScript中的比较运算符可以用于判断数字的大小。以下是常用的比较运算符:
- `>`:大于
- `=`:大于等于
- ` num2) {
console.log("num1大于nu
原创
2023-08-04 15:01:49
1507阅读
# 判断一个值是否为数字的方法
## 介绍
在开发中,我们经常需要判断一个值是否为数字。对于MySQL数据库而言,它提供了一些函数和操作符来实现这一功能。本文将介绍如何使用MySQL来判断一个值是否为数字。
## 流程图
```mermaid
flowchart TD
A(开始)
B(输入值)
C(使用正则表达式判断)
D(判断结果)
E(输出结果)
原创
2023-11-29 10:55:27
77阅读
js如何判断输入字符串长度
这篇文章主要介绍了js判断输入字符串长度,汉字算两个字符,字母数字算一个,感兴趣的小伙伴们可以参考一下
js判断输入字符串长度(汉字算两个字符,字母数字算一个) 文本输入时,由于数据库表字段长度限制会导致提交失败,因此想到了此方法验证。 废话不多说上代码: <
html
>
转载
2023-06-17 17:34:55
299阅读
# Java判断是数字的方法
## 1. 概述
在Java中,我们可以使用多种方法来判断一个字符串是否为数字。本文将介绍一种常用的方法,通过判断字符串是否能够成功转换为数字来判断。
## 2. 判断流程
下面是判断一个字符串是否为数字的流程:
| 步骤 | 处理方式 |
| --- | --- |
| 1 | 检查字符串是否为空,如果为空则不是数字 |
| 2 | 使用`try-catch`
原创
2023-10-16 05:43:36
55阅读
## JavaScript判断一个输入是数字的方法
### 一、流程图
```mermaid
flowchart TD
A[开始]
B[获取用户输入]
C[判断输入是否为空]
D[判断输入是否为数字]
E[输出结果]
A --> B
B --> C
C -- 空 --> E
C -- 非空 --> D
D -- 是
原创
2023-09-04 03:18:53
168阅读